Job Description

Job Description and Duties

Hybrid Telework Opportunity.

The Associate Governmental Program Analyst (Health and Safety Coordinator) under the general direction of the Staff Services Manager II in the Procurement and Contract Services Branch independently performs the more complex analytical and technical work associated with health and safety matters and a wide variety of analytical assignments.

The Associate Governmental Program Analyst (Health and Safety Coordinator) develops, administers, maintains and evaluates administrative systems and practices aligned with state and departmental policy in areas such as health and safety, emergency response, hybrid work structure, records management, facilities coordination, departmental trainings, injury and illness prevention program, and continuity planning.

  • Statement of Qualifications - Applicants must submit a Statement of Qualifications (SOQ) responding to the criteria listed below. The SOQ is a narrative discussion of how your education, training, experience, and skills qualify you for this position. It will be used as the first step in the screening process to determine the most qualified candidates.

    Your SOQ must: Be no more than two (2) pages in length; Use 12-point font and standard margins; Include your full name and the Job Control number at the top of each page; Address each criterion in order, using the criterion number and header

    1. Describe your experience developing, implementing, and maintaining policies and procedures related to occupational health and safety, illness prevention, and hybrid workforce planning, ensuring compliance with Cal/OSHA, State Administrative Manual (SAM), and departmental requirements.
    Emergency Preparedness and Continuity Planning.

    2. Explain your experience creating, coordinating, or maintaining emergency preparedness, response, and continuity of operations programs in alignment with Standardized Emergency Management System (SEMS), National Incident Management System (NIMS), or Federal Continuity Directives.

    3. Discuss how you have applied analytical skills to assess risks, monitor compliance, or produce reports that influenced safety, emergency preparedness, or workforce planning decisions.
